Matthew 12:25-29
English Standard Version
25 (A)Knowing their thoughts, (B)he said to them, “Every kingdom divided against itself is laid waste, and no city or house divided against itself will stand. 26 And if Satan casts out Satan, he is divided against himself. How then will his kingdom stand? 27 And if I cast out demons by Beelzebul, (C)by whom do (D)your sons cast them out? Therefore they will be your judges. 28 But if it is (E)by the Spirit of God that I cast out demons, then (F)the kingdom of God has come upon you. 29 Or (G)how can someone enter a strong man's house and plunder his goods, unless he first binds the strong man? Then indeed (H)he may plunder his house.

Luke 11:17-22
English Standard Version
17 (A)But he, (B)knowing their thoughts, said to them, “Every kingdom divided against itself is laid waste, and a divided household falls. 18 And if Satan also is divided against himself, how will his kingdom stand? For you say that I cast out demons by Beelzebul. 19 And if I cast out demons by Beelzebul, (C)by whom do (D)your sons cast them out? Therefore they will be your judges. 20 But if it is by (E)the finger of God that I cast out demons, then (F)the kingdom of God has come upon you. 21 When a strong man, fully armed, guards his own palace, his goods are safe; 22 (G)but when one stronger than he attacks him and (H)overcomes him, he takes away his (I)armor in which he trusted and (J)divides his spoil.
